“…The function of nicotine on cancer cells at the nAChR subtype level is valuable for cancer prevention and treatment ( Russo et al, 2011 ; Wu et al, 2011 ; Cardinale et al, 2012 ; Yang et al, 2013 ). In keratinocytes, α3β2-nAChR and α7-nAChR are necessary for nicotinergic chemokinesis, and α9-nAChR is critical for adhesion and motility ( Chernyavsky et al, 2004 ; Arredondo et al, 2006 ; Dong et al, 2016 ). Similarly, in breast epithelial cells α9-nAChR is responsible for nicotine-stimulated cell growth and malignant transformation ( Lee et al, 2010 ; Tu et al, 2011 ).…”
